September 19th Path Valley; Tim Mertz takes the win and extends his lead in the Hyper Cup.

With yet another perfect racing surface, Tim Mertz made great use of his front row starting position to take the win over Ryan Greth with Jason Morrison in 3rd.

This week’s result mirrors the current Championship leader board with all three podium finishers in an identical position in the chase for the coveted Hyper Cup.

In victory lane Tim said “A special thanks must go to Path Valley for providing a great racing surface tonight. I was lucky to be able to take advantage of my front row starting position and to have Ryan come home in second is keeping the excitement in the point’s battle. My team really has our RTS working fantastic at Path Valley. I have to give a lot of thanks to our team made up of, Dad, Ron and Joe. None of this would be possible without the support of Mertz's Moving, Allison Door Sales, Guhl Motors and RTS chassis.”

Jason Morrison made multiple attempts in the last 3 laps to pass Greth on the low side, but Greth held the cushion to take 2nd.

The question on the night….Where was the full moon ?? The Sidewinder Sprints managed 3 flips for the night with Rohan Beasley and Gary Funck performing a double flip in the first heat, and then in the feature, Stan Fleming ended upside down after contact with Funck.

With Beasley out for the night with extensive damage, he put his time to good use with the radar gun in turn one.

For those that have always wondered, here are the results from the main events for the open wheel classes;

270’s – 63MPH
600’s – 69MPH
Sidewinders – 78MPH
305 Sprints – 79MPH
